Feng Shui for Business Premises and Shops
Your business space is more than a workplace — it’s a magnet for opportunities, customers, and growth. In Feng Shui, the layout, cleanliness, and energy flow of your shop or office can directly impact success, profitability, and reputation. Stagnant, cluttered, or poorly arranged spaces can block Chi, while a harmonious environment attracts positive energy, abundance, and loyal clients.
Why Feng Shui Matters for Businesses
The flow of Chi in a business setting affects sales, teamwork, and overall prosperity. Open, clean, and well-arranged spaces encourage customer engagement, smooth operations, and employee motivation. Conversely, clutter, dark corners, or blocked pathways can subtly hinder growth and create stress in staff and clients alike.
The Feng Shui Approach to Business Premises
● Entrance Focus: Keep entryways clean, bright, and welcoming; this is where energy and customers enter.
● Open Layout: Avoid cluttered aisles or cramped displays; Chi should circulate freely.
● Cash and Finance Area: Position cash registers or finance counters where energy can be supported by visibility and accessibility.
● Lighting and Airflow: Natural light and fresh air energize the premises, keeping both staff and clients uplifted.
Tips for Specific Areas
Shop Floor / Display Area:
● Keep products organized and easy to access.
● Use mirrors or reflective surfaces to expand space and energy.
● Highlight bestsellers or new items in prominent positions.
Office or Backroom:
● Maintain cleanliness and order to support smooth operations.
● Avoid storing clutter near entrances or workstations.
Customer Interaction Spaces:
● Create welcoming seating or waiting areas.
● Use comfortable, clear pathways for easy movement.
Color and Material Considerations
● Red or Gold Accents: Attract attention, energy, and prosperity.
● Green or Wooden Elements: Encourage growth and trust.
● Metal Elements: Symbolize precision, efficiency, and financial flow.
● Reflective Surfaces: Polished floors, mirrors, or glass counters help circulate energy.
Mindful Maintenance
● Sweep, mop, and dust floors and surfaces regularly.
● Declutter shelves, counters, and storage areas consistently.
● Keep entrances and windows clean to invite fresh energy.
● Play soft background music or use subtle scents to uplift ambiance.
